When it comes to timing belts on 70‑80 s Japanese engines, I’ve found the “DIY‑full‑rebuild” route beats the “just‑swap‑the‑belt” shortcut. Using the factory service manual (or a reputable reproduction) and pulling the belt with a proper pulley holder lets you inspect the tensioner, idler pulleys, and water pump seal at the same time. A cheap belt‑puller kit from a salvage yard can do the job, but the extra 15‑20 minutes you spend checking the surrounding hardware saves you a future failure that a simple belt swap often misses.
Oil change intervals are another area where the classic‑car mindset differs from modern “high‑mileage” schedules. For a 1.0–1.3 L SOHC engine, I stick to a 3,000‑mile (≈4,800 km) interval with 10W‑30 synthetic, which is only a shade more frequent than the original 2,500‑mile recommendation but far less aggressive than the 1,000‑mile rule you sometimes see on hobby‑ist forums. The gain in engine longevity outweighs the cost of an extra quart of oil every few months, especially when you’re already changing the filter as part of the routine.
Detecting cooling‑system wear without fancy tools is surprisingly straightforward: keep an eye on three tell‑tale signs. First, a slow rise in coolant temperature after a short warm‑up (you can feel the radiator cap feel hotter). Second, any visible coolant residue or chalky deposits around hose clamps—those are early mineral deposits that will eventually block flow. Third, a slight, consistent loss of coolant over a week, which you can catch with a simple 1‑gallon jug test. If any of those show up, a flush with a vinegar‑water mix followed by a standard coolant flush is a cheap preventive step.
For interior and paint care on a shoestring budget, I compare two approaches: the “budget‑detail” method versus the “full‑repaint” route. A cheap interior cleaner (a mix of diluted dish soap and water) plus a soft‑bristle brush will keep dash and seat fabrics from cracking, while a few coats of clear UV‑resist spray (often sold for motorcycle helmets) will protect vinyl panels. On the paint side, a DIY polishing kit using a cheap foam pad and a mild abrasive polish can restore gloss without the expense of a professional clear coat, especially if you’re only dealing with light oxidation. Prioritize the timing belt and cooling‑system checks first—those are the mechanical heartbeats—then slot in interior clean‑up on weekends and paint touch‑ups when you have a spare afternoon. This way you keep the car running and looking decent without letting any single task dominate your limited time.
